22nd Авг 2021

0 Comments

bash-148836_640

Как запускать команду в Linux в консоли через заданное время?

Чтобы запускать команду в Linux в консоли через заданное время надо задействовать команду watch. Синтаксис: watch [options] command Например, запускать df каждые 10 секунд: watch -n 10 df -h Остановить ctrl+c. — Дополнительный источник —…

Прочитать

4th Авг 2021

0 Comments

bash-148836_640

Как проверить работу gzip сайта при помощи curl?

Проверить работу gzip можно отправив запрос при помощи curl: curl -H «Accept-Encoding: gzip» -I https://example.com В ответе должна быть информация о gzip: HTTP/1.1 200 OK Server: nginx Date: Sat, 02 May 2015 15:00:09 GMT Content-Type:…

Прочитать

3rd Авг 2021

0 Comments

bash-148836_640

Как найти рабочие хосты в подсети через Linux?

Например, нам надо найти все работающие хосты (если файерволом не закрыты) в диапазоне 10.126.0.1-20: echo 10.126.0.{1..20} | xargs -n1 -P0 ping -c1 | grep «bytes from» | grep 10.126.0 Детальный разбор приведенной команды с параметрами…

Прочитать

3rd Авг 2021

0 Comments

bash-148836_640

Как отфильтровать ip адреса по максимальному количеству запросов в Linux из логов?

Пример выборки: tail -n 400000 access.log | grep ’01/Aug/2020:13′ | cut -d ‘ ‘ -f 1 | sort | uniq -c | sort -n | tail -n 30 Детальный разбор приведенных команд с параметрами через…

Прочитать